Lead author, Bernardo Lessa Horta of the Federal University of Pelotas in Brazil said, "The likely mechanism underlying the beneficial effects of breast milk on intelligence is the presence of long-chain saturated fatty acids (DHAs) found in breast milk, which are essential for brain development.
"Our finding that predominant breastfeeding is positively related to IQ in adulthood also suggests that the amount of milk consumed plays a role," he added.
Breastfeeding has clear short-term benefits, but it is interesting to see the positive impact that this has in later life.
